ITSM Isn’t Rocket Science — It Just Needs a Reboot

After my last post, the feedback was clear: ITSM has become over-engineered and expensive. It’s time for a rethink.

For 20 years, vendors promised “Out-of-the-Box” solutions, yet almost every customer ended up with heavy customisation, technical debt, and painful upgrades. The problem isn’t the tools anymore — it’s mindset.

Most ITSM needs aren’t unique. Over-customising adds cost, complexity, and poor ROI. Data quality and process ownership matter far more than code.

That’s why HaloITSM takes a different path:

  • Best practices built-in – using the Service Automation Framework (SAF).

  • Transparent, affordable licensing – only pay for fulfillers.

  • Free integrations and AI – no hidden extras.

  • No-code configuration – faster, simpler, lower TCO.

ITSM doesn’t need to be complicated; it needs to be smarter, leaner, and focused on people — not endless development.
